About Hijili

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Hijili village is 389504. Hijili village is located in Bangiriposi tehsil of Mayurbhanj district in Odisha, India. It is situated 12km away from sub-district headquarter Bangiriposi (tehsildar office) and 45km away from district headquarter Baripada. As per 2009 stats, Kusumbandha is the gram panchayat of Hijili village.

The total geographical area of village is 153 hectares. Hijili has a total population of 948 peoples, out of which male population is 460 while female population is 488. Literacy rate of hijili village is 48.31% out of which 56.96% males and 40.16% females are literate. There are about 241 houses in hijili village. Pincode of hijili village locality is 757092.

Baripada is nearest town to hijili for all major economic activities, which is approximately 50km away.
